Chada Chada is a Thai restaurant serving a variety of the most popular Thai dishes. They specialise in red and green curry and vegetarian dishes. Catering for private parties of up to 50 guests is available upon request.

Wandered into this restaurant after finding a huge queue at Busaba Eat Thai. We might as well have queued there as it took 40 minutes for our starter to arrive, and about 35 minutes before staff became aware of us trying to get their attention. In addition to this, it took three requests for water (pre-starter, during starter and during main meal) before we finally got any. Food was good, but then we were so hungry by the time that it arrived how could it not be?

Chose restaurant randomly after a day of shopping, lovely small restaurant with nice relaxing atmosphere. Had the most amazing steamed dumplings to start and then delicious halibut. So nice not to be eating in one of the same old chain restaurants, and have a Thai meal that wasn't ridiculously heavy and made you wonder just how many colourings/tinned ingredients had gone into it! Really nice fresh food, will definitely be going back.
